“…According to Cuckler (1961), this anthelmintic is particularly effective for roundworms belonging to the orders Strongyloidea, Ascaroidea, and Trichinelloidea. For human helminthic infections, remarkable thera peutic effects have been reported against ascariasis, strongyloidiasis, trichuriasis, trichostrongylosis, trichinosis, enterobiasis, and ancylo stomiasis (Franz, 1963;Huang and Brown 1963;Iwata et al 1963;Stone et al 1964;Salunkhe et al 1964;Spaeth et al 1964;Papasarathorn 1964;Chango 1964;Shah 1965). …”
